Vancouver Institute of Philosophy for Children

Dr. Susan Gardner (Capilano University) and Dr. Barbara Weber (UBC) are the co-directors of the Vancouver Institute for Philosophy for Children (VIP4C). Our goals are: the development of a university curriculum on “Philosophy for Children” (P4C), as well as to integrate this dialogue method into the teacher education programs in BC; the organization of a “National Body of Philosophy for Children” in Canada;

to help organize schools projects and have entire schools use this dialogue method for teaching and conflict resolution; organise local and international conferences; offer workshops, philosophical cafes, and summer institutes. This summer we are organising the Think Fun P4C summer camps for BC youngsters. The Think Fun camps have three themes: Creative Sparks, Curious Critter and Ideas Alive.
